A scratch built large scale model in an exquisite fine museum quality of a common late medieval (15th Century) bombard (or houfnice, howitzer) mounted on carriage with rayed wheels, a solid two parts wooden gun-carriage with a metal iron sight to elevate and aim. Also known as "Bombardella" and "Bombardella Borgogna", was "gettata in bronzo, su affusto campale, legate al ceppo con circoli di ferro" so, these artillery pieces were in bronze or in wrought iron in different calibres, ideal to shoot iron or stone projectiles to incoming enemy troops.
